Integrating Chatbots Across Academic Subjects
As schools adopt digital tools, chatbots are emerging as effective resources across various academic subjects. Utilizing chatbots as personalized assistants can enhance both teaching methodologies and learning outcomes.
In language arts, chatbots can deliver immediate feedback on writing and reading assignments, facilitating a more responsive educational experience. For foreign language instruction, they function as interactive conversation partners, providing instant corrections which can enhance speaking proficiency.
In social studies, chatbots can simulate discussions with historical figures, thereby promoting critical thinking and engagement with historical contexts. Mathematics education can also benefit, as chatbots can offer customized explanations and practice problems tailored to individual student needs.
Furthermore, in STEM disciplines, AI applications help address complex queries and support exploratory learning in programming and scientific inquiry, fostering a more interactive and accessible educational environment.

Managing Data Privacy and Ethical Considerations
The use of AI chatbots in educational settings necessitates a careful focus on data privacy and ethical considerations throughout the implementation process. Compliance with regulations, such as the Family Educational Rights and Privacy Act (FERPA), is essential in safeguarding confidential student records from unauthorized access.
It's important to refrain from sharing sensitive information with chatbot systems and to develop explicit guidelines for all users involved.
To ensure that data remains secure, institutions should implement strong security measures, including encryption and access controls, to protect against potential breaches.
Regular reviews of policies and procedures are necessary to maintain ethical standards and address any emerging concerns.
Moreover, ongoing monitoring of chatbot interactions can help identify and mitigate any biases present in the system. This reinforces a culture of responsible AI use within the educational environment.
Evaluating and Improving Chatbot Effectiveness
To ensure that an AI chatbot effectively benefits students and supports their learning, it's important to evaluate its performance using specific metrics such as response accuracy, engagement rates, and user satisfaction scores. Regularly collecting user feedback can help identify areas for improvement and inform subsequent development efforts.
Employing structured assessment rubrics can aid in evaluating the chatbot's clarity, relevance, and creativity in responses.
Additionally, integrating diverse pedagogical strategies, such as scaffolding techniques and metacognitive prompts, can enhance the chatbot's capabilities in facilitating learning. Training for users is also critical, as it enables students to interact with the chatbot more effectively and refine their inquiries, which can improve the overall user experience.
Moreover, continuous testing and iterative refinement of the chatbot are vital to maintaining its effectiveness and adaptability to changing educational needs. Through these measures, the AI chatbot can serve as a supportive tool in the learning process for students.
